Understanding Poses in Dress to Impress
Posing in a dress to impress involves more than just standing in front of the camera. It’s about understanding how your body moves, how your dress drapes, and how lighting interacts with both. When done correctly, the right pose can highlight your best features and create a lasting impression.
To start, consider the type of dress you’re wearing. Different dresses call for different poses. For example, a flowy maxi dress might look best with soft, flowing movements, while a fitted cocktail dress might benefit from more structured poses. Always think about the dress's silhouette and how it complements your body.
Key Elements of Successful Posing
- Focus on your posture – good posture can make any pose look better.
- Engage your core muscles to maintain balance and create a more defined silhouette.
- Experiment with angles – try turning your body slightly to create depth in the image.
Poses for Different Body Types
One size does not fit all when it comes to posing in a dress. Different body types require different approaches to flatter and accentuate your unique features. Here’s a breakdown of how to pose according to your body shape:
Pear-Shaped Bodies
For pear-shaped bodies, focus on drawing attention upward. Use poses that elongate your legs and highlight your upper body. Consider tilting your head slightly and lifting your chin to create a more balanced look.
Apple-Shaped Bodies
Apple-shaped bodies benefit from poses that emphasize the waist and hips. Try turning your body slightly to one side and placing your hands on your hips to create curves. This can help create the illusion of a more defined waistline.
Hourglass Figures
Hourglass figures naturally have curves that are perfect for posing. Show off your figure by placing your hands on your hips or slightly twisting your torso to highlight your waist.

Mastering Camera Angles
Camera angles play a crucial role in how your pose is perceived. The right angle can enhance your features and create a more flattering image. Experiment with different angles to see what works best for you.
Low angles can make you appear taller and more commanding, while high angles can highlight your face and upper body. Side angles can create depth and dimension, making your poses more dynamic.
Tips for Camera Angles
- Try shooting from slightly above eye level for a more flattering perspective.
- Experiment with close-ups to focus on your facial expressions.
- Use wide shots to capture the full length of your dress and body.
Expert Posing Tips for Dresses
Now that you understand the basics, let’s dive into some expert tips for posing in a dress. These techniques will help you feel more confident and create stunning images that impress.
1. Use Your Hands Strategically
Your hands can be a powerful tool in posing. Place them on your hips, gently touch your hair, or let them drape naturally by your sides. Avoid rigid or awkward hand placements that can detract from your pose.
2. Focus on Your Feet
Your feet can help create balance and stability in your pose. Try standing with one foot slightly in front of the other or pointing your toes to elongate your legs.
3. Engage Your Face
Your facial expression can make or break a pose. Smile genuinely, tilt your head slightly, or look off into the distance for a more contemplative look. Always engage your eyes to draw attention to your face.
Advanced Posing Techniques
Once you’ve mastered the basics, it’s time to explore advanced posing techniques that can take your images to the next level. These techniques are perfect for those looking to create truly impressive and memorable photos.
1. The Twirl
The twirl is a classic pose that works especially well with flowy dresses. Spin around slowly to create movement and drama in your image. This technique is perfect for outdoor shoots or when you want to capture the essence of your dress.
2. The Lean
Leaning against a wall, railing, or other surface can create a relaxed and effortless look. Pair this with a slight tilt of your head and a confident smile to make the pose more dynamic.
Enhancing Your Look with Accessories
Accessories can elevate your dress and enhance your overall look. Consider adding jewelry, scarves, or hats to complement your outfit and create a more polished appearance. Accessories can also serve as props in your photos, giving you more options for creative poses.
Choosing the Right Accessories
- Select accessories that match the style and color of your dress.
- Avoid over-accessorizing, as this can detract from your dress.
- Experiment with different accessories to find what works best for your look.
The Importance of Lighting
Lighting is a critical component of any successful photo shoot. The right lighting can enhance your features, create depth, and add dimension to your images. Natural light is often the best choice, especially during the golden hour when the sun is low in the sky.
When shooting indoors, look for soft, diffused lighting to avoid harsh shadows. Use reflectors or additional lighting sources to fill in any dark areas and create a more balanced image.
